Description

The player is the second officer of a space ship. He uses the Shadow Skimmer glider to make a routine inspection of the engines. Unfortunately the main computer malfunctions and closes the entry point. Now he needs to reach another hatch, but the defense systems see him as intruder.

The player needs to navigate through three top-down mazes and find the exit. Unfortunately those are not passable until the security systems are put down: it is necessary to find and destroy the hidden power device. Sometimes it is necessary to flip the glider on the back to pass through certain obstacles, but this makes the glider vulnerable for enemy attacks. Those, along with bumping against obstacles, decrease the glider's shield energy and when all three are gone, the game is lost. The glider has a laser to shoot back. However, a killed enemy is instantly replaced by an indestructible enemy generator.
